Abstract
Description
【産業上の利用分野】 雪冷房システム設置室内の空気
を換気し、冷却しようとする空気を雪貯蔵槽に入れる前
に、雪が溶解した冷たい水にエアー冷却水中ラジエータ
ーを取り付け、それに空気を通すことによって、冷却さ
れた空気を雪貯蔵槽に入れる。[Industrial application] Before ventilating the air in the room where the snow cooling system is installed and putting the air to be cooled into the snow storage tank, attach an air-cooled underwater radiator to cold water in which snow is melted and let air pass through it. Place the cooled air into the snow storage tank.
【従来の技術】 なし[Prior Art] None
【発明が解決しようとする課題】 雪冷房システム設置
室内の空気を、直接雪貯蔵槽に送り込むことによって、
雪が早く溶解しやすい。[Problems to be Solved by the Invention] By directly feeding the air in the snow cooling system installation room to the snow storage tank,
Snow melts quickly and easily.
【課題を解決するための手段】 冷却しようとする空気
を、ひとたびエアー冷却水中ラジエーターに入れてから
雪貯蔵槽に送ることによって、雪が溶解する速度を遅く
する。Means for Solving the Problems The air to be cooled is once introduced into an air-cooled underwater radiator and then sent to a snow storage tank, thereby slowing down the melting speed of snow.
【作用】 雪の溶解速度が遅くなる。[Operation] The melting speed of snow becomes slow.
【実施例】 雪冷房システムの雪貯蔵槽の雪溶解ピット
に入れる。[Example] A snow storage pit of a snow cooling system is placed in a snow melting pit.
【発明の効果】 雪の溶解速度が遅くなることによっ
て、貯蔵槽内の雪をよりいっそう長持ちさせ、また雪の
貯蔵量を少なくできることによって雪貯蔵槽の小型化が
できる。EFFECTS OF THE INVENTION By slowing the melting rate of snow, the snow in the storage tank can last longer, and the storage amount of snow can be reduced, so that the snow storage tank can be downsized.
